Medicines Supply Notification: Abidec® multivitamin drops

NCL Wide

The Department of Health and Social Care has issued a medicines supply notification for Abidec® multivitamin drops. 

Actions for prescribers

  • Review existing patients to determine if Abidec® multivitamin drops are still required.
  • Consider prescribing Dalivit® oral drops for young children where appropriate, ensuring that the patient is not intolerant to any of the excipients, and parent(s)/carers are counselled on the appropriate dose and volume required. Vitamin A content and the patient's age should be considered as Dalivit® use in children under six weeks old is off-label (see supporting information)
  • Or consider prescribing or recommending alternative vitamins or food supplements where appropriate, particularly for older children and adults who require ongoing treatment.

Prescribers are also signposted to the NPPG guidance.

ScriptSwitch® messages have been enabled to provide information on this shortage to support primary care.

For detailed information on the shortage, clinicians should refer to the SPS Medicines Shortage Tool for actions required and supporting information.
